Also airplanes have armour and armour thickness, bullets have effective range.

Many pilots are protected by ~20mm pilot armour (effective thickness - because angle of impact/armour slope is a thing too just like with tanks!). Engines and fuel tanks too.

Firing from closer will blast right through such armour and destroy whatever is in the way. This is usually under 500 meters or so.

Firing from afar will lead to the bullet bouncing off the armour harmlessly.

Additionally, the modification that upgrades your guns makes them TOO accurate IMO. I recommend turning it off to increase gun spread. This maximizes the chances that you hit a vital component when you fire rather than lasering a tiny spot.

Not sure, if it’s because of the spars eating AP rounds or if the incendiary rate was lowered but API-T isn’t as effective as it used to be.

But it’s still the best you can pick, since API and API-T are the only real damage dealer for US .50cals, since Incendiary bullets offer no advantage at the moment.

I always felt like I was the only person with this opinion, glad to see im not alone

General rule of thumb, avoid any purely Incediary rounds, they can even get past the fabric skin of reserve aircraft or the glass of most cockpits. Let alone a fuel tank.
